Learning Objectives

Upon completion of this activity, participants should be able to:

  • Compare and contrast HBV and HIV infections
  • Discuss strategies to combat HBV drug resistance
  • Discuss antiviral drugs and their potency in the HBV infection setting

Topics covered include:

  • Introduction
  • Comparison of HIV and HBV
  • Replication Capacity and Viral Fitness
  • Archived Virus and Reservoirs
  • Nucleos(t)ide Resistance: HIV and HBV
  • Strategies to Prevent the Development of Drug Resistance
  • Conclusion
